Skuld, whose name translates as “what is to come,” is the Norn of the future. She guards the knowledge of what has not yet been revealed—of the fate that is still taking shape and the burden of responsibility that the future brings. She records the course of coming events and sees their consequences before they become reality. Skuld embodies mystery, uncertainty, and the effects of choices made in the here and now. Her presence reminds us that present decisions are intertwined with future events, combining the inevitability of fate with the possibility of hope.
In Germania Mint’s vision, Skuld is depicted as an enigmatic figure shrouded in a hood and a long cape, concealing what remains beyond human understanding. Human skulls hang from her hips — a sign of transience and the price that must be paid for insight into the future. In her hand she holds a sharp knife with which she cuts the thread of life, deciding the fate of those who dare to look into her prophecies. Skuld stands at the roots of Yggdrasil, among the fallen and the still living, surrounded by numerous swords that foreshadow battles yet to be fought.
